Abstract

The invention particularly relates to an anti-leakage construction method for an outer door and a window edge of an outer heat insulation wall on ground. The anti-leakage construction method is characterized by comprising the following steps of installing an outer door or outer window auxiliary frame on a wall at a base layer, and filling a gap by waterproof mortar; installing an outer door or outer window main frame, sealing a gap by waterproof sealant, and covering the waterproof mortar onto the outside of the waterproof sealant to realize sealing protection; constructing a leveling layer on the wall at the base layer; brushing waterproof coating on the outside of the waterproof mortar, and constructing a heat insulation layer on the waterproof coating; constructing a decoration layer of the outer wall surface on the heat insulation layer, and sealing a chamfer between the outer door or outer window main frame and the decoration layer of the outer wall surface by waterproof and weather-resistant sealant. The anti-leakage construction method has the advantages that by adopting common construction materials and universal tools, the anti-leakage effect of the outer door and window edge of the outer heat insulation wall is improved; the problem of easiness in aging and cracking of weather-resistant rubber between the outer door and window frame and the building wall is solved, the common problem of leakage of the outer door and window edge of the outer heat insulation wall is solved, and the subsequent maintenance cost caused by leakage is reduced.

Description

technical field [0001] The invention relates to the construction field of building exterior walls, in particular to an anti-leakage construction method for exterior doors and window edges of above-ground exterior thermal insulation walls. Background technique [0002] The anti-leakage of the external door and window edge of the above-ground external thermal insulation wall in the prior art is to seal the gap between the outer (door) window frame and the outer wall surface decoration layer with waterproof and weather-resistant sealant to achieve the anti-leakage effect. Therefore, when the waterproof and weather-resistant sealant ages, it is easy to leak at the door and window, which eventually leads to repairs and increases the final construction cost.
